Waterproofing is one of the most important things you can do for your home, but many people have no idea what it involves. Most homeowners are familiar with foundation waterproofing, which makes sure that water stays out of the area where a building's foundation is located. Remedial waterproofing, on the other hand, focuses on keeping water out of the parts of your house that are above ground.
 
What is Remedial Waterproofing?
Remedial waterproofing in Sydney is an important part of any building project. It makes sure that your basement or the underground area will not leak, no matter what kind of foundation you have.
 
Why is Remedial Waterproofing Important?
Basements are prone to water leaks, especially if they were not built with a waterproof covering or coating. If your basement leaks, it can lead to expensive damage that could have easily been avoided. Waterproofing also keeps mould and mildew at bay, which can cause health problems and expensive repairs.
